The Crew 2, Surviving Mars, And Frostpunk: Console Edition Joins PlayStation Now

The three games are available now.

The year is fresh and new once again, and it’s time for new games, and there are so many different services nowadays for all the players out there. One of those is PlayStation Now, Sony’s original streaming service that can sometimes go a bit under the radar. But there’s lots of titles there, and today we have three more.

The Crew 2, Ubisoft’s acclaimed racing title, is the headline game as you race against land, air and sea with a variety of vehicles from cars to bikes to boats. Next up is Surviving Mars, where you must build a sustainable and comfortable colonization on the red planet. On the opposite end is Frostpunk: Console Edition, where it’s not about comfort but surviving the extreme cool and try to maintain a steam-fueled city among a narrative of corruption.

The Crew 2, Surviving Mars and Frostpunk: Console Edition are available now on PS Now. You can read the full details through here.
